Ascent Logistic Park - Leighton Buzzard

           This large-scale logistics project delivered 37 fully equipped loading bays, installed as part of a fast-paced warehouse development from the earliest construction stages through to completion. The works began while the site was still being prepared for structural lifting operations, with close coordination required around ongoing construction activity, cladding installation, and phased equipment deliveries arriving on site.

Dock Levellers
Installation of the dock levellers formed the core of each loading position, providing a safe and efficient bridge between warehouse floors and vehicles.

 

Each unit was positioned and integrated to support reliable loading operations and high traffic volumes.

Sectional Doors
High-performance sectional doors were installed across all loading bays, delivering secure access, thermal efficiency, and smooth operation while complementing the building structure and cladding layout.

Dock Lights
Dock lighting systems were fitted to improve visibility within trailers and loading areas, supporting safer handling operations and efficient movement of goods during all working hours.

Traffic Lights
Traffic light systems were installed externally to assist vehicle control and improve safety during loading and unloading procedures, helping coordinate vehicle movements across the busy logistics hub.

Dock Bumpers
Heavy-duty dock bumpers were fitted to protect both the building façade and loading equipment from repeated vehicle impact, increasing durability and reducing maintenance requirements.

Dock Shelters
Dock shelters were installed to create a protected seal between vehicles and the building, helping shield loading activities from weather conditions while improving energy efficiency inside the facility.

Wheel Guides
Wheel guides were positioned at each bay to support accurate vehicle alignment, improving docking precision and helping protect loading equipment during daily operations.

Fire Exit Doors
Fire exit doors were installed throughout the facility to provide safe and clearly designated escape routes in the event of an emergency.

 

Designed as an essential part of the building’s fire safety strategy, these doors help protect evacuation routes by resisting the spread of fire and smoke for a specified period, allowing occupants more time to exit safely and supporting emergency response procedures.
